## Read-Replica Lag Alarm

Welcome to on-call life at Fernbrook! Our replicas usually trail the primary by under a second, but batch imports can push lag into the danger zone where stale reads start confusing users. The lag alarm fires in two stages: a soft warning that pings the channel, and a hard page when lag crosses the critical line for a sustained window. Please don't tweak thresholds in the console — they're code-managed so changes get reviewed. Here are the constants the alarm currently uses.

tuning constants:
QUOTAS = {
    "druwyn": 5,
    "holix": 5,
    "zorath": 5,
    "holwyn": 10,
}

Leadership Review Briefing — Marketing Budget Reduction

For heads of department: the executive committee has approved a 22% reduction in the marketing budget for Halwyn Brands, effective next quarter. Sponsorships and the regional campaign in the Estermere market will be paused; digital channels supporting the Quillet product launch are protected. Each department should identify dependent activities by the planning deadline. The rationale ties to a broader repositioning, and the confidential note on those plans is provided below.

management briefing: Istaelix Group is in early talks to buy Sorysax Logistics for about $496.2 million. The Kasox launch date is October 3, and nothing goes to the press before then. Legal wants the Norokax Foods term sheet withdrawn before April 25.

## Runbook: Vendoring Third-Party Fonts

If the Typeshed mirror goes down, don't panic — we vendor all licensed fonts into the Quillbox repo. Run the sync script, verify checksums against the manifest, and commit the updated bundle. Heads up: the script talks to the internal license-check service, so it needs auth. Use the key that follows.

service key, tadup-tahog: zpat7_wB1tnEL

Onboarding snippet for the weekly eng sync — Project Cleave. We're extracting the user module from the Bramblewick monolith into its own service. Phase one moves auth and profile reads behind the new API; writes stay in the monolith until the dual-write audit passes. Expect the sync to cover cutover dates and ownership of the shared session table. New service deploys go through the Cleave pipeline, which requires signed manifests. The pipeline's signing key is the following.

release key, hadug-kawef: bky13_mPGeFZeR1GZ1G